noun which may take the genitive case particle 'no'
on the bone; bone-in
Describes meat or fish sold or served with the bone still attached. Often used in food contexts.
骨付きの鶏もも肉を買ってきた。
I bought bone-in chicken thighs.
この店の骨付きカルビは絶品だ。
The bone-in short ribs at this restaurant are exquisite.

Compound of 骨 (bone) + 付き (attached, from 付く). Literally 'with bone attached'.
